JAMSHEDPUR – A viral video shows Dumri MLA breaking a युवक’s phone during a candle march in Bokaro over a murder case.
A candle march was held in support of the Pushpa murder case. Meanwhile, the event took place in Chas block under Pindrajora police station.
A large crowd gathered at Jodhadih More for the march. Moreover, Dumri MLA Jayaram Mahato attended after receiving an invitation.
However, a disagreement started between the MLA and locals. Soon, the situation escalated into a heated argument.
Meanwhile, a युवक was recording the incident on his phone. The MLA became angry after noticing the recording.
He then snatched the phone from the युवक. Moreover, he threw it on the ground, breaking it.
The entire act was captured and shared online. Consequently, the video spread rapidly across social media platforms.
Supporters of the MLA began raising slogans. As a result, the situation became more tense.
On the other hand, local residents expressed strong anger. Many questioned the conduct of a public representative.
However, the march was meant to remain peaceful. The incident disrupted its intended purpose.
Meanwhile, the MLA left the spot in his vehicle. The tension reduced after his departure.
The case relates to a widely discussed murder incident in the area. Moreover, such protests often demand justice and accountability.
However, this episode has triggered debate online. People are raising concerns about leaders’ behavior.
